Question 989361: A pizza restaurant has two diffrent drivers on duty each day. In one day, the first driver delivers an average of x pizzas and the second driver delivers an average of y pizzas. The first driver works M days per week. While the second driver works N days per week
•what does the expression MX + NY represents?
•if both drivers work M days per week,what are the factors of the new expression,MX+MY?
